Output 7026a798ebbebac560090ac17e5c68d590bd17e8986add31a76f32148e6e4ad8:0

value
1231340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e42cbfbe15a8ead668473d03d730cbd56c073cb OP_EQUAL
address
3EfDtubEbswW7Tb3C8nLCdpgNq65oKJEDE
transaction
7026a798ebbebac560090ac17e5c68d590bd17e8986add31a76f32148e6e4ad8
confirmations
177379
spent
true